我在允许用户上传他们自己的图片的站点上使用 bootstrap3。这些图像稍后显示在给定页面中。问题是,一些用户上传的照片相对于容纳它们的 div 来说要么更大要么更小。我希望使用 CSS(如果需要,甚至是 JavaScript)调整所有这些图像的大小,以便它们适合 div,同时保持它们的纵横比。同时,我希望他们能够做出响应。
最佳答案
在图像上使用 img-responsive
类。
来自Bootstrap documentation : "通过添加 .img-responsive
类,Bootstrap 3 中的图像可以响应友好。这适用于 max-width: 100%;
和 height: auto;
到图像,以便它可以很好地缩放到父元素。”
关于javascript - CSS 调整图像大小以适应 div 并响应,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/27923635/